我在我的项目中使用Orange Pi,我搜索了如何通过python控制其引脚,并找到了一些建议安装接线Pi的结果 。我从https://github.com/WiringPi/WiringPi安装了WiringPi,也安装了pip,但在这两种情况下它都不起作用。我尝试使用WiringPi时收到此警告: 无法确定硬件版本。我明白了:硬件:sun8i ' - 期待BCM2708或BCM2709。 如果这是一个genuino Raspberry pi,那么请报告这个 到projects@drogon.net。如果这不是Raspberry Pi那么你 因为WiringPi旨在支持 Raspberry PI ONLY。
答案 0 :(得分:2)
您可以通过orangepi官方网页找到 Orange Pi 接线Pi版本:http://www.orangepi.org/Docs/WiringPi.html
答案 1 :(得分:0)
/tmp/WiringPi-Python-OP-master
)WiringPi
子目录中提取(例如/tmp/WiringPi-Python-OP-master/WiringPi
)cd /tmp/WiringPi-Python-OP-master; python setup.py install
我刚刚在我的OrangePI-PC上进行了测试,效果非常好。
(original instructions here, also check if you miss any dependency)。
答案 2 :(得分:0)
你应该使用pyH3库。 你可以从下载: https://github.com/duxingkei33/orangepi_PC_gpio_pyH3 然后安装此软件包
sudo apt-get install python-dev
提取(phyh3)文件夹并放入'/ home / pi' 和
cd orangepi_PC_gpio_pyH3
并运行python setup.py install
现在已安装库。
您可以在文件夹示例中使用测试代码 https://github.com/duxingkei33/orangepi_PC_gpio_pyH3/tree/master/examples